In article <59cc47995c.harriet@bazleyfamily.co.uk>, Harriet Bazley <harriet@bazleyfamily.co.uk> wrote: > On 11 Jan 2026 as I do recall, > > > Should that bit of code be put in an obey file? I'm a bit hazy on the > > technical side. > > > It's a BASIC program. > Save it as a file of type BASIC (&FFB) and double-click the file to run > it. > Or save it into your root directory, open a taskwindow, and type > *Run <filename> > in order to get the results in a form that can be copied and pasted; > mine gives: > Sound system has 9 sample rates available > Index 1 rate 8000 Hz > Index 2 rate 11025 Hz > Index 3 rate 12000 Hz > Index 4 rate 16000 Hz > Index 5 rate 22050 Hz > Index 6 rate 24000 Hz > Index 7 rate 44100 Hz > Index 8 rate 48000 Hz > Index 9 rate 96000 Hz Ta. -- Chris Newman
